What Makes a Parking System “Smart”?

A traditional parking system controls access and collects payment. A smart parking system does that and adds layers of technology that automate decisions, track data, and connect your facility to drivers before they arrive.

The core technologies driving smart parking:

License Plate Recognition (LPR)

AI-powered cameras identify every vehicle automatically. Recognized parkers — monthly, pre-booked, validated — enter without stopping. Transient plates are logged and tied to payment at exit.

IoT Occupancy Sensors

In-ground magnetic sensors, overhead ultrasonic units, and camera-based analytics track every space in real time — feeding live counts to entrance signage, apps, and your operations dashboard.

Dynamic Pricing

Rates adjust automatically based on real-time demand, time of day, day of week, or scheduled events. Changes apply instantly across all terminals, pay stations, and booking channels — no staff site visits required.

Cloud Analytics Platform

CloudEASE ties LPR, sensors, payment terminals, and gates into one real-time dashboard. Revenue per lane, live occupancy, equipment status, automated alerts — all from any browser, all facilities at once.

Reservation & Pre-Booking

Drivers find, book, and pay before they leave home. Reservations tie to LPR plate match or QR code — gate opens automatically at arrival. Real-time available space counts update to prevent overbooking.

Open API & Integrations

RESTful API with no hard rate limits connects to hotel PMS (Oracle Opera, Maestro), access control platforms, accounting systems, building management, and third-party aggregators.

The level of “smartness” is scalable — start with LPR and cloud software, add sensors and dynamic pricing as revenue justifies. Parking BOXX smart parking systems are modular. No forced full-system replacement.

Core technology

License Plate Recognition (LPR) Technology

LPR is the single most impactful smart parking technology. AI-powered cameras at entry and exit capture every vehicle’s plate in real time, serving as the primary entry layer — registered plates open the gate automatically; unregistered vehicles fall back to ticket dispensing.

How LPR Works

1
Capture: High-resolution cameras capture plate images as vehicles approach the entry lane.
2
Read: AI OCR reads the plate in under 1 second with high accuracy.
3
Match: System checks the plate against monthly parkers, reservations, validation lists, and enforcement databases.
4
Access — recognized: Gate opens automatically. No ticket, no credential, no stopping.
5
Access — transient: Plate logged with entry timestamp. Driver pays at kiosk or mobile before exiting; exit gate confirms payment via plate match.

What LPR Eliminates

  • Paper tickets — and paper jams
  • Lost-ticket disputes and manual overrides
  • Manual credential management for monthly parkers
  • Revenue leakage from tailgating or ticket swapping
  • Cashier booth labor for routine entry/exit
  • Post-visit collections and citation mailing

Parking BOXX AI LPR cameras are designed specifically for parking environments — optimized for variable lighting, angled plates, and high-speed reads in congested lanes.

Occupancy intelligence

IoT Sensors & Real-Time Occupancy Tracking

Smart parking IoT deploys sensors throughout the facility to track occupied/available spaces in real time — transforming operation from reactive to proactive.

Types of Smart Parking Sensors

In-Ground Magnetic Sensors

Detect individual vehicle presence in each space. High accuracy, low maintenance, ideal for outdoor surface lots and exposed decks.

Overhead Ultrasonic Sensors

Mount on garage ceilings, detect vehicle presence via sound waves. Ideal for covered structures — no ground installation required.

Lane Loop Detectors

Embedded in lane pavement to count vehicles entering and exiting — provide zone-level occupancy without per-space sensor investment.

Camera-Based Analytics

Use existing security cameras with AI to detect space occupancy — no additional hardware required when camera infrastructure already exists.

What Real-Time Tracking Enables

  • LED signage at entrance and each level shows live space counts
  • Feed availability data to website, apps, Google Maps, and Waze
  • Trigger automatic lot-full closures before overflow occurs
  • Provide operators with historical occupancy patterns for staffing and rate optimization

A parking lot tracking system built on IoT sensors transforms your operation from reactive to proactive. Instead of discovering a facility was over-capacity after the fact, operators receive alerts and can take action in real time — rerouting vehicles, adjusting signage, or opening overflow areas.

Revenue optimization

Dynamic Pricing & Revenue Optimization

Dynamic pricing adjusts rates automatically based on real-time demand, time of day, day of week, or scheduled events.

When occupancy is high — events, weekday commute, holiday shopping — rates increase. When occupancy is low — rates decrease to attract vehicles.

The smart parking platform manages rate rules centrally. Changes apply instantly across all entry terminals, pay stations, online booking channels, and mobile payment apps. No manual repricing. No staff site visits.

Dynamic pricing rules can be event-triggered (concerts, sports games), schedule-based (rush hour, overnight), or fully automated — responding to real-time occupancy thresholds without any manual intervention.

Pre-booking

Reservation & Pre-Booking Integration

Smart parking systems let drivers find, book, and pay before they leave home — generating revenue in advance and giving operators accurate demand forecasting.

How Reservations Work

1
Book: Driver books via branded web portal, mobile-responsive booking page (no app download), or third-party aggregator APIs.
2
Arrive: Entry terminal verifies via LPR plate match, QR code scan, or confirmation number.
3
Enter: Gate opens automatically. No stopping, no manual credential check.
4
Inventory: System adjusts real-time available space counts to prevent overbooking.

Event Parking Strategy

  • Guarantee capacity for VIP and premium parkers while remaining inventory goes to transient traffic at dynamic rates
  • Pre-sell event parking weeks in advance — revenue collected before game day
  • Reduce entry queue backup with pre-verified LPR entry
  • Accurate demand forecasting for staffing and rate decisions

Frequently Asked Questions About Smart Parking Systems

What is a smart parking system?
A smart parking system automates vehicle identification, payment processing, and occupancy tracking using technology like license plate recognition (LPR), IoT sensors, cloud-connected management software, and dynamic pricing engines. Unlike traditional parking that relies on paper tickets and cashier booths, a smart parking system captures every vehicle's license plate at entry, manages access in real time, and lets operators control the entire facility from any browser. Parking BOXX manufactures modular smart parking systems for single lots, multi-level garages, and multi-facility portfolios.
How does license plate recognition work in a smart parking system?
LPR cameras at each entry and exit lane capture high-resolution images as vehicles approach. AI-powered OCR software reads the plate in under one second and checks it against a database of monthly parkers, reservations, validated vehicles, and enforcement lists. Recognized vehicles — monthly parkers, pre-booked drivers — have the gate open automatically without stopping. Transient vehicles are logged with an entry timestamp and plate number, then pay at a walk-up kiosk or via mobile before exiting. The system ties the plate to the payment, confirming the session is settled before releasing the exit gate.
What IoT sensors are used in smart parking?
Smart parking IoT typically uses four sensor types: in-ground magnetic sensors that detect individual vehicle presence per space; overhead ultrasonic sensors mounted on garage ceilings; loop detectors embedded in lane pavement to count vehicles entering and exiting zones; and camera-based analytics that use existing security cameras with AI software to detect space occupancy without additional hardware. Parking BOXX smart parking systems integrate sensor data directly into the CloudEASE dashboard for real-time occupancy monitoring.
Can a smart parking system provide real-time space availability?
Yes. When IoT sensors track individual space occupancy, the system can display real-time availability counts on LED signage at the facility entrance and on each level. The data can also be fed to the facility website, mobile apps, and third-party platforms like Google Maps or Waze. Real-time availability helps drivers make faster decisions, reduces circling traffic, and allows the smart parking platform to trigger automatic lot-full closures and alert operators before a facility reaches capacity.
What is dynamic pricing in a smart parking system?
Dynamic pricing automatically adjusts parking rates based on real-time occupancy, time of day, day of week, or scheduled events. When occupancy is high — during events, peak commute times, or holiday shopping — rates increase to match demand. When occupancy is low, rates decrease to attract vehicles. The smart parking platform manages all rate rules centrally, so changes apply instantly across entry terminals, pay stations, online booking channels, and mobile payment apps without requiring staff site visits. Dynamic pricing typically increases overall parking revenue by 10–30% compared to static flat rates.
How do smart parking systems handle reservations?
Smart parking systems connect to reservation and pre-booking platforms that let drivers find, book, and pay for parking before they leave home. Reservations are accepted through a branded web portal, mobile-responsive booking page (no app download required), or third-party aggregator APIs. At arrival, the entry terminal verifies the booking via LPR plate match, QR code scan, or confirmation number — the gate opens automatically. The system adjusts available space counts in real time to prevent overbooking, and for events, guaranteed capacity for VIP or premium parkers can be managed separately from transient inventory.
